## Changelog — Driftgate 2.4

Heads up, support folks: we've tightened the default canary gating rules. New deploys now need two clean evaluation windows instead of one before promotion, and the error-rate threshold dropped a bit. Translation: canaries will sit in the oven slightly longer, so expect a few "why is my deploy stuck" tickets. The new default gating configuration is listed below.

settings of kawig-kahip:
ULAETH_PIN=4988
ULAETH_TENANT=briath
ULAETH_METRICS_HOST=metrics.ulaeth.xolmarworks.test
ULAETH_SEAL=seal_e1a2fe42
ULAETH_STANDBY_TEAM=pelix

## Authentication

The Murmuret service is chatty by design, so we sample logs at 2% before shipping them to the Lanternfall aggregator. Sampling rates are configured per-route in sampler.yaml; bump a route to 100% only during active incidents and revert within 24 hours. All writes to the aggregator's ingest endpoint require an internal service key scoped to the murmuret-logs project. For the weekly sync demo, use the shared staging credential. The current key is appended below.

gateway credential: kto3_qfe

Subject: Quickstore 4.2 — bloom filter now fronts the KV layer

Plugin authors: starting with this release, Quickstore places a bloom filter ahead of the key-value store. Negative lookups return faster; false positives fall through safely. No API changes are required on your side. Verify your plugin against the staging build referenced below.

session token of fahif-tadup = htk3_9c7

Handover note — Crumbwheel order cutoffs.

Welcome aboard. The bakery cutoff rule in Crumbwheel closes same-day orders at 14:00 local to each storefront, not UTC — this has bitten us twice. Holiday overrides live in the calendar service and take precedence silently, so always check there first when a cutoff looks wrong. To unlock the calendar service's admin console after a restart, enter the recovery passphrase below.

vault phrase of bagap-bahaf = silion-pelox-sorox-casdor-quenwyn-fraax-eliox-praael-kelion-quenvan-kasox-rusael-norius-belvan